Wheel alignment encompasses three critical geometric angles: camber, caster, and toe. Camber refers to the inward or outward tilt of the tyre when viewed from the front, while caster defines the forward or rearward slope of the steering axis. Toe specifies the extent to which the front or rear tyres point inward or outward relative to the vehicle centreline.
Discrepancies in these angles cause excessive friction and scrubbing against the asphalt. Operating a misaligned vehicle creates unnecessary financial expenses for the driver. When tyres scrub against the road surface, rolling resistance increases significantly, forcing the internal combustion engine or electric powertrain to consume more energy. Furthermore, uneven tread wear can destroy expensive tyre sets in a fraction of their intended lifespan.
